位置:百问excel教程网-excel问答知识分享网 > 资讯中心 > excel问答 > 文章详情

excel中空格为什么不给替换

作者:百问excel教程网
|
185人看过
发布时间:2026-01-14 19:30:37
标签:
Excel中空格为什么不给替换?在Excel中,空格的处理方式与数字、文本等数据类型有显著不同,这背后涉及Excel的底层逻辑与数据存储机制。通常来说,空格在Excel中不会被“替换”,这并非由于技术问题,而是基于数据结构与功能设计的
excel中空格为什么不给替换
Excel中空格为什么不给替换?
在Excel中,空格的处理方式与数字、文本等数据类型有显著不同,这背后涉及Excel的底层逻辑与数据存储机制。通常来说,空格在Excel中不会被“替换”,这并非由于技术问题,而是基于数据结构与功能设计的合理选择。本文将从多个角度,深入探讨Excel中空格为何不被替换,以及其背后的原因和实际应用中的影响。
一、Excel中的空格与数据类型
Excel中的数据类型主要包括数字、文本、逻辑值(TRUE/FALSE)、错误值(NUM!、VALUE!)等。其中,文本类型是Excel中最基本的数据类型,用于存储字符串。在Excel中,文本数据与数字数据是相互独立的,具有不同的存储方式和处理规则。
空格在Excel中被视为文本数据,但与数字不同,空格不具有数值意义。在Excel中,空格实际上是一个字符,而非数值。因此,Excel在处理数据时,会将空格视为一个特殊的字符,而不会将其视为数值进行计算。
二、Excel的内部数据结构
Excel的数据存储方式基于二进制,每个单元格存储的数据以二进制形式表示。在Excel中,文本数据以Unicode字符的形式存储,而空格作为一种字符,其编码形式是U+0020,在Excel中是合法的文本字符。
然而,Excel对数据的处理方式并非直接操作字符,而是通过公式、函数和操作来实现数据的处理。例如,`LEN()`函数用于计算文本长度,`LEFT()`、`RIGHT()`、`MID()`等函数用于提取文本的一部分,`CONCATENATE()`、`&`操作符用于拼接文本。这些操作都是基于文本的,而空格作为文本的一部分,不会被“替换”。
三、Excel中的空格与替换功能
在Excel中,“替换”功能用于将一个文本中的特定字符替换成其他字符。例如,将“ABC”中的“B”替换为“X”。这一功能是基于文本的,因此空格作为文本的一部分,不会被替换。
在Excel中,替换功能的操作是基于字符的匹配。例如,替换“ ”(空格)为“_”(下划线),Excel会将所有空格替换成下划线。这种操作是基于字符的,而不是基于数值的。
四、Excel中空格为何不被替换
在Excel中,空格不被替换的原因主要有以下几点:
1. 空格是文本的一部分
空格在Excel中被视为一个字符,而不是一个数值。在Excel中,空格的存储形式是文本,因此,在数据处理中,空格作为一个字符被保留,不会被“替换”。
2. 替换功能基于字符匹配
Excel的“替换”功能是基于字符的匹配,而非数值的计算。例如,替换“ ”为“_”时,Excel会将每个空格视为一个字符,并将其替换为下划线。这种操作是基于字符的,而不是基于数值的。
3. 数据处理的底层逻辑
Excel的数据处理底层基于二进制存储,而空格作为一种字符,其存储形式是固定的。在Excel中,空格不会被“替换”,是因为它的存储形式不会被修改。
五、Excel中空格的使用与影响
在Excel中,空格的使用有其特定的场景和目的。例如,空格常用于数据分隔格式化文本拼接。以下是一些实际应用中的情况:
1. 数据分隔
在Excel中,空格常用于数据分隔,例如在导入数据时,空格用于分隔不同的字段。例如,从CSV文件导入数据时,空格用于分隔不同的列。
2. 格式化
在Excel中,空格常用于格式化,例如在单元格中使用空格来增加视觉上的分隔,使数据更清晰。
3. 文本拼接
在Excel中,空格常用于文本拼接,例如在使用`CONCATENATE()`函数时,空格用于拼接不同的文本。
六、Excel中的空格与公式
在Excel中,空格的使用与公式密切相关。例如,`LEN()`函数用于计算文本长度,`LEFT()`、`RIGHT()`、`MID()`用于提取文本的一部分,`CONCATENATE()`用于拼接文本,`&`用于连接文本。
这些公式都是基于文本的,因此空格作为文本的一部分,不会被“替换”。
七、Excel中空格的特殊处理
在Excel中,空格的处理方式与数字、文本等数据类型不同,因此在某些情况下需要特别处理:
1. 空格在公式中的作用
在公式中,空格常用于分隔不同的参数,例如在使用`IF()`、`VLOOKUP()`等函数时,空格用于分隔不同的参数。
2. 空格在数据导入中的作用
在导入数据时,空格常用于分隔不同的字段,例如在CSV文件中,空格用于分隔不同的列。
3. 空格在格式化中的作用
在Excel中,空格常用于格式化,例如在单元格中使用空格来增加视觉上的分隔。
八、Excel中空格的常见问题与解决方案
在实际使用中,空格可能会带来一些问题,例如:
1. 空格导致数据错误
在某些情况下,空格可能导致数据错误,例如在使用`VLOOKUP()`函数时,空格可能导致查找失败。
2. 空格导致格式错误
在使用格式化功能时,空格可能导致格式错误,例如在使用“设置单元格格式”时,空格可能导致格式不正确。
3. 空格导致计算错误
在使用公式时,空格可能导致计算错误,例如在使用`SUM()`函数时,空格可能导致计算结果错误。
九、Excel中空格的未来发展趋势
随着Excel功能的不断进化,空格的处理方式也在不断优化。未来,Excel可能会引入更灵活的空格处理方式,例如允许用户自定义空格的处理规则,或者在某些情况下允许空格“替换”。
然而,目前Excel的空格处理方式仍然是基于字符的匹配,因此在实际应用中,空格不会被“替换”。
十、总结
在Excel中,空格不被替换,是基于数据类型、存储方式和处理逻辑的必然结果。空格作为文本的一部分,不会被“替换”,但其使用在数据分隔、格式化和文本拼接中具有重要作用。随着Excel功能的不断进化,空格的处理方式可能会有所变化,但目前仍然以字符处理为主。
对于用户而言,理解空格在Excel中的行为,有助于更有效地使用Excel进行数据处理和格式化。在实际操作中,应根据具体需求合理使用空格,以达到最佳的处理效果。
推荐文章
相关文章
推荐URL
为什么Excel里公式不执行?在使用Excel进行数据处理和分析时,一个常见的问题就是公式不执行。许多用户在使用Excel时,可能会遇到公式没有计算、结果没有变化、或者计算结果不正确的情况。这些情况虽然看似简单,但在实际操作中
2026-01-14 19:30:34
359人看过
Excel群发用什么软件好?全面解析在Excel中进行群发操作,是许多用户在日常工作中常见的需求。无论是批量发送邮件、任务通知,还是数据导出,Excel本身功能有限,难以满足高效、便捷的需求。因此,许多用户会选择使用专门的群发软件来提
2026-01-14 19:30:28
357人看过
Excel A A 是什么意思?详解 Excel 中 A A 的含义与使用方法在 Excel 中,A A 是一种常见的单元格引用方式,通常用于表示一个单元格的地址。然而,这种写法在实际应用中并不常见,甚至在官方文档中也未被明确提及。本
2026-01-14 19:29:16
346人看过
用Excel时有tmp文件是什么在使用Excel进行数据处理和分析的过程中,用户可能会遇到“tmp文件”这一术语。这个术语在Excel的使用过程中并不常见,但确实存在。tmp文件通常指的是临时文件,其作用是帮助Excel在处理大量数据
2026-01-14 19:28:54
250人看过
热门推荐
热门专题:
资讯中心: